How do I fix the "unable to fast travel" bug in RDR2?
The ''unable to fast travel'' bug in Red Dead Redemption 2 can be frustrating, especially when you''re trying to save time or complete missions efficiently. Fast travel is a key mechanic in the game, allowing players to quickly move between discovered locations using stagecoaches, trains, or the camp''s fast travel map. However, certain conditions or bugs can prevent this feature from working. Here''s how to fix the issue and ensure smooth gameplay.\n\nFirst, ensure that you meet the basic requirements for fast travel. Fast travel becomes available after upgrading Arthur''s camp with Dutch''s lodging and purchasing the fast travel map from the ledger. If you haven''t done this, visit your camp and interact with the ledger near Dutch''s tent. Purchase the upgrade for $220, and the fast travel map will appear near Arthur''s cot. Without this upgrade, fast travel is not possible, so this is the first step to troubleshoot.\n\nIf you''ve already unlocked fast travel but still can''t use it, check your current in-game situation. Fast travel is disabled during missions, when you have a bounty, or if you''re in a restricted area like Saint Denis or Blackwater. For example, if you''re in the middle of a story mission or have a high bounty, the game will block fast travel until the situation is resolved. Pay off your bounty at a post office or complete the mission to regain access.\n\nAnother common issue is the fast travel map not appearing in your camp. This can happen due to a bug or if the map is obstructed. To fix this, try saving your game and reloading it. If the map still doesn''t appear, leave the camp and return after a few in-game days. Sometimes, simply restarting the game or reloading a previous save can resolve the issue.\n\nIf you''re using a stagecoach or train for fast travel, ensure you have enough money. Stagecoaches cost $5-$15 depending on the distance, while trains are slightly more expensive. If you''re low on funds, the game won''t allow you to fast travel. Earn money by completing missions, hunting, or selling items to general stores. Additionally, make sure you''re at a valid fast travel point. Not all towns have stagecoaches, so check the map for icons indicating fast travel options.\n\nFor players experiencing persistent issues, consider clearing the game''s cache. On consoles, this involves fully closing the game, restarting the system, and relaunching RDR2. On PC, verify the game files through your platform (Steam, Epic Games, etc.) to ensure no corrupted data is causing the bug. If all else fails, contact Rockstar Support for further assistance.\n\nFinally, here are some practical tips to avoid the ''unable to fast travel'' bug: always keep your camp upgraded, pay off bounties promptly, and save your game frequently. If you''re exploring new areas, unlock fast travel points by visiting towns and interacting with stagecoaches.
